#SurvivingRKelly: Lady Gaga Apologizes For Past Collaboration With R. Kelly; Takes Song Off Streaming Platforms



American pop star, Lady Gaga, has tendered a heartfelt public apology for her 2013 collaboration with embattled RnB singer, R. Kelly, who is currently plagued with series of sexual allegations.

According to 32-year-old’s statement posted on Twitter after the recent Lifetime documentary series which chronicled allegations of abuse, predatory behaviour, and paedophilia against singer R.Kelly, Gaga said she will bee removing her 2013 collaboration “Do What U Want” with Kelly from iTunes and other streaming services.

In the statement, Gaga said she made the record at a time in her life when she was angry and defiant as a result of what she went through as someone who also is a victim of sexual assault after he was sexually assaulted at age 19.

She also committed to always stand by anyone who has ever been the victim of sexual assault.
